The Berber Hypothesis is a working assumption (or educated guess) that ancient Berber voyagers reached the New World, some of them ultimately settling in what is now Talossa. The Berber Hypothesis is one of the bases for the 1994 proclamation that Talossa is “inextricably and inexplicably connected somehow to Berbers,” and explains the Berber and North African Latin influences on El Glheþ.
